Subject: [PATCH 17/29] dmx3191d: Use IRQ_NONE

Testing shows that the Domex 3191D card never asserts its IRQ. Hence it is
non-functional with Linux (worse, the EH bugs in the core driver are fatal but
that's a problem for another patch). Perhaps the DT-536 chip needs special
setup? I can't find documentation for it. The NetBSD driver uses polling
apparently because of this issue.

Set host->irq = IRQ_NONE so the core driver will prevent targets from
disconnecting. Don't request the irq.

 drivers/scsi/dmx3191d.c |   25 ++++++++-----------------
 1 file changed, 8 insertions(+), 17 deletions(-)

Index: linux/drivers/scsi/dmx3191d.c
===================================================================
--- linux.orig/drivers/scsi/dmx3191d.c	2014-10-02 16:56:14.000000000 +1000
+++ linux/drivers/scsi/dmx3191d.c	2014-10-02 16:56:16.000000000 +1000
@@ -34,6 +34,8 @@
  * Definitions for the generic 5380 driver.
  */
 
+#define DONT_USE_INTR
+
 #define NCR5380_read(reg)		inb(port + reg)
 #define NCR5380_write(reg, value)	outb(value, port + reg)
 
@@ -89,32 +91,23 @@ static int dmx3191d_probe_one(struct pci
 	if (!shost)
 		goto out_release_region;       
 	shost->io_port = io;
-	shost->irq = pdev->irq;
 
-	NCR5380_init(shost, FLAG_NO_PSEUDO_DMA | FLAG_DTC3181E);
+	/* This card does not seem to raise an interrupt on pdev->irq.
+	 * Steam-powered SCSI controllers run without an IRQ anyway.
+	 */
+	shost->irq = IRQ_NONE;
 
-	if (request_irq(pdev->irq, NCR5380_intr, IRQF_SHARED,
-				DMX3191D_DRIVER_NAME, shost)) {
-		/*
-		 * Steam powered scsi controllers run without an IRQ anyway
-		 */
-		printk(KERN_WARNING "dmx3191: IRQ %d not available - "
-				    "switching to polled mode.\n", pdev->irq);
-		shost->irq = IRQ_NONE;
-	}
+	NCR5380_init(shost, FLAG_NO_PSEUDO_DMA | FLAG_DTC3181E);
 
 	pci_set_drvdata(pdev, shost);
 
 	error = scsi_add_host(shost, &pdev->dev);
 	if (error)
-		goto out_free_irq;
+		goto out_release_region;
 
 	scsi_scan_host(shost);
 	return 0;
 
- out_free_irq:
-	if (shost->irq != IRQ_NONE)
-		free_irq(shost->irq, shost);
  out_release_region:
 	release_region(io, DMX3191D_REGION_LEN);
  out_disable_device:
@@ -131,8 +124,6 @@ static void dmx3191d_remove_one(struct p
 
 	NCR5380_exit(shost);
 
-	if (shost->irq != IRQ_NONE)
-		free_irq(shost->irq, shost);
 	release_region(shost->io_port, DMX3191D_REGION_LEN);
 	pci_disable_device(pdev);
